Mariano Lopez 3b95964bc1 qemurunner: Remove the timeout in run_serial
Sometmes when there is high load in the server the
commands executed in the target take a lot of time
to complete and this lead to incorrect dump files or
empty files. This is caused because run_serial has a
timeout of five seconds when running the commands in
the target.

This change removes the timeout and just keep reading
the socket until it finds the prompt from the target
or when the socket is not ready to be read.

Mark Hatle 920fb964d6 gcc: Update default Power GCC settings to use secure-plt
The gcc default, bss-plt, will cause errors when using the prelinker.  All
other distributions that I am aware of are using the the secure-plt.  For an
explanation of the differences, the gcc docs:

  Current PowerPC GCC accepts a `-msecure-plt' option that generates code
  capable of using a newer PLT and GOT layout that has the security
  advantage of no executable section ever needing to be writable and no
  writable section ever being executable. PowerPC ld will generate this
  layout, including stubs to access the PLT, if all input files (including
  startup and static libraries) were compiled with `-msecure-plt'.
  `--bss-plt' forces the old BSS PLT (and GOT layout) which can give
  slightly better performance.

The security of the new PLT and ability to run the prelinker outweigh
any performance penalty.

The secure-plt is enabled by default.  The old bss-plt can be enabled by
selecting 'bssplt' in the DISTRO_FEATURES.

Mark Hatle 7b1763a248 glibc: Fix ld.so / prelink interface for ELF_RTYPE_CLASS_EXTERN_PROTECTED_DATA
A bug in glibc 2.22's ld.so interface for the prelink support causes
the displayed values to be incorrect.  The included path fixes this
issue.

   Clear ELF_RTYPE_CLASS_EXTERN_PROTECTED_DATA for prelink

   prelink runs ld.so with the environment variable LD_TRACE_PRELINKING
   set to dump the relocation type class from _dl_debug_bindings.  prelink
   has the following relocation type classes:

   where ELF_RTYPE_CLASS_EXTERN_PROTECTED_DATA has a conflict with
   RTYPE_CLASS_TLS.

   Since prelink doesn't use ELF_RTYPE_CLASS_EXTERN_PROTECTED_DATA, we
   should clear the ELF_RTYPE_CLASS_EXTERN_PROTECTED_DATA bit when the
   DL_DEBUG_PRELINK bit is set.

Josh Cartwright c0fe43cdbe rt-tests: bump to v0.94
All of the rt-tests patches that OE has been carrying have been
upstreamed or superceded by changes in the v0.94 release.

Adjust SRC_URI to point to canonical upstream git repo, instead of a
development tree.

There was a notable change upstream that required slight reworking of
the recipe.  rt-tests now joins other kbuild-inspired projects by making
use of a CROSS_COMPILE flag to indicate the compiler prefix.

Previously TOOLCHAIN_OPTIONS were conveyed via $CC directly, however,
this does not work with CROSS_COMPILE.  Workaround this by both
specifying CROSS_COMPILE, and feeding the rt-tests build system the
proper $(HOST_CC_ARCH)$(TOOLCHAIN_OPTIONS) via $CFLAGS.

Jens Rehsack cf972f9abf gbm: Fix "configure: error: gbm requires --enable-dri"
When building mesa without X11 enabled, and disabling dri package config,
the enforced "--enable-gbm" fails building mesa, because this feature
requires "--enable-dri", too - which has been disabled by package config.

Consequently, when gbm requires dri, --disable-dri causes in --disable-gbm,
which makes explicit --disable-gbm in case of --disable-dri redundant.

Alexander D. Kanevskiy aa1844e847 combo-layer: introduce ability to exclude component from mass update
There is no ability at the moment for situations where users would like
to keep section in combo-layer.conf but don't update it, unless explicitly
specified.

Now, by adding "update = no" to desired section would exclude
that repository from "combo-layer update" command.

It is still possible to explicitly update it by "combo-layer update $section".

By default, all repositories are assumed as "update = yes"
